Upon entering the NFL, Robert Griffin III was instantly the most electric player in the league. As the years have gone by, though, he's been riddled with injuries, and even spent 2017 entirely out of football. Now a member of the Baltimore Ravens, he threw his first touchdown pass since 2016 in the 2019 season's first week, and he's reflecting on his journey back to this pointincluding nearly switching to another sport.
